What would it take to install adjustable pedals into my Ram? I have the switch, and I'm assuming the wiring can be gotten at a junk yard, it appears to just go between the switch and the pedal assy. The pedal assy is available at not too great a price.

I removed my clock spring, to install a new leather steering wheel with heat, and discovered that the wiring for the adjustable pedals is already in place, so I need to find the wiring at the other end. It doesn't go thru any main connectors under the dash, so, I believe it is just point to point. However, to find the other end, I'll need to remove the steering column and the bracket the pedals are attached to. Wish me luck.

Job done. I actually upgraded the dash wiring harness, which included the heated seat support. The existing harness already has the connectors for both ends of the adjustable pedals. I have since added memory seats, wired the connection to the drivers door, for the mirror memory, and the 7 wires needed for the pedal memory. All works great now.

Hello Harry, I was wondering what wires and where do these wires go for memory setting. I have installed Laramie heated/vented memory seats in my 2015 Big Horn, and activated the cooling, but would like to add the memory settings, and power pedals now after reading what you did. So, just wondering where the extra wires need to go from the seat as they are missing from my truck side harness.Also, where the plug for the power pedals is located. Thanks in advance.

The connector at the steering wheel goes to a blank. You can find the wiring diagrams for your vehicle here. You should have a connector tucked into the harness next to the steering column. That will be the connector for the power adjust. You will need to upgrade the drivers door module to the one with power fold mirrors, as the memory function is in that module, and you will need to run 2 wires from the seat module to the drivers door module. The power pedal wiring will have to be redone at the power adjust switch, because it is wired for non-memory. You will need to add several wires under the drivers seat to the pedal switch as well. It's complicated, but doable.
